After more than a year of development, we are very pleased to finally share with you our first RC (Release Candidate) of version 1.0.0 of Tainacan  

This is the first version of Tainacan to bring a set of changes large enough to be considered “breaking,” meaning that a lot has changed.

Highlights:

  • A brand new Admin Home Page with cards linking to key areas, documentation, and news.
  • A modernized Admin Interface — more responsive, accessible, and customizable, with adjustments available per user role.
  • Introducing the Settings Page: fine-tune plugin behavior, default views, indexing, and page templates.
  • Say hello to “My Items”: a new way to quickly view items you’ve created.
  • Navigation Revamp: clearer menus and a new sidebar with version info and direct links.
  • Reorganized menus for better usability: reports, exporters, and processes now have their own contextualized places.
  • New Gutenberg block: “Items Related to This”, pulling in related items based on metadata.
  • Developers: get access to new base classes, modular components, form hooks, and improved structure under the hood.

Frequently asked questions

Can I go back to having the Tainacan administrative panel hiding the WordPress panel as it was before? Yes! On the home screen, go to the upper right corner under “Screen Options” and select “Hide WordPress navigation”

How do I install it? Download the .zip file here and in the WordPress Admin Panel go to → Plugins → Add plugins → Upload plugin. After installing, go to any Tainacan page and clear your browser cache for that page at least once (CTRL+SHIFT+R).

I want to go back to the previous version. What do I do? Simply remove the plugin and download the version available in the WordPress plugin repository (0.21.16) again.

What do you mean by “break”? Will I lose my data? No, don’t worry… the new version does not change your repository data. However, it drastically changes where things are located (mostly in the administrative section). In the rare cases where you have made customization via code to the Tainacan administrative interface (such as using environment variables to hide elements), these changes may indeed cease to have effect and code adjustments will be necessary. Links to the admin page may also change if you have ever written one manually in some page or documentation.
